Why do whips hurt so much? - Physics Stack Exchange The reason, a Whip hurts so much is that the tip of whip moves extremely fast, causing the skin to tear The reasoning behind this is easy to analyze from momentum conservation Lets take a convenient approximation, that the mass per unit length ($\rho$) does not vary through the length of the whip This is not how real whips are, but it will not affect the conclusion very much Initially, the

These were Stanley Pons and Martin Fleischmann They reported on March 23, 1989 on press conference that they found a new way for fusion at room temperature Their paper was published on April 10, 1989 in J Electroanalytical Chemistry and Interfacial Electrochemistry Their experiment was from conceptual point of view very simple
